Output 84a3662c3ad882dd3f8f2505dd8962d831da0314f0d647243a3bde27aacaca7d:0

value
316130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985e6408fa0d74b658199d8ee2e42846e64fdfa3 OP_EQUAL
address
3Fafi61F6QxG8H77wJSbEUSvB3TAhuLjZV
transaction
84a3662c3ad882dd3f8f2505dd8962d831da0314f0d647243a3bde27aacaca7d
spent
true